Beni Mellal is cute enough.

Beni Mellal is cute enough. The town seems chill and gives the right kind of Moroccan vibes. Since we went during Ramadan, eating wasn't much of a highlight: in the daylight hours we were forced to accept McDonald's drive-thru before heading out on a day trip, but that night we had pizza at Davinci Restaurant, which was surprisingly quite good (particularly if you're familiar with pizza in Morocco) and overall well managed. The region is even more spectacular: drive over the mountain range to Bin El Ouidane (1 hour) and continue to Ouzoud Falls (1 hour more) via Azilal (about midway in between). Gorgeous terrain!
